Friends for Leadership at SPIEF: more than 100 next generation leaders and entrepreneurs will participate in the Forum

13 June 2022

With the support of the Roscongress Foundation, the St. Petersburg International Economic Forum will once again open its doors to the representatives of the Friends for Leadership (FFL) international community of next generation leaders and entrepreneurs, who have been working on the platforms of the Roscongress Foundation since 2018. This year, SPIEF traditionally invited over 100 young leaders from 42 countries of the CIS, Asia, Africa, Latin America and Europe, to participate at the Forum.

Over the several days of work during the SPIEF, FFL program delegates will take part in a number of Forum sessions and hold series of their own events together with Rossotrudnichestvo, Department of Foreign Economic and International Relations of Moscow, All-Russian Society for Nature Conservation, Agency for Strategic Initiatives, Higher School of Economics and other partners to discuss and develop innovative and social projects from the portfolio of the Friends for Leadership participants.

FFL will have a busy schedule of working meetings and strategic sessions on the implementation of their projects in Russia and the world, as well as holding open discussions about the views of young leaders on the most pressing issues on the global economic agenda, including food security, digital cooperation, the implementation of scientific and student exchanges, cultural and humanitarian initiatives and promoting the implementation of the UN 2030 Agenda for Sustainable Development.

The work of international youth delegates at SPIEF will continue efforts to promote multilateral economic and humanitarian projects, which started in 2018, when FFL representatives first united at SPIEF. Many projects will help attract new popular ideas and technologies to Russia and other countries. In addition, the participants will discuss and plan to hold a series of further events with foreign partners at foreign venues using the resources and capabilities of the FFL, the Roscongress Foundation, the Center for International Promotion, Government of Moscow and Rossotrudnichestvo, which traditionally acts as a partner in FFL’s participation at SPIEF as part of the New Generation program, ensuring the participation of 70 delegates at the forum.

It is expected that following the results of the work of the FFL delegation, roadmaps for the joint implementation of participants’ projects will be developed, a number of cooperation agreements will be signed and new international initiatives for Russian and foreign youth will be announced.
